Docker部署jpress

1.下載鏡像,運行容器,進入容器node

下載vi和vim
apt-get updateapt-get -y install vim
mysql

2.編寫dockerfilegit

用戶帳號(root也行),建立一個文件夾,文件夾下放jpress.war和文檔Dockerfilegithub

下載jpress.war、解壓、更名
下載:wgethttps://github.com/JpressProjects/jpress/archive/0.4.0.tar.gz​解壓:tar xf 0.4.0.tar.gz更名:mv jpress-web-newest.war ~/docker-admin/jpress.war
web

vim Dockerfile
from hub.c.163.com/library/tomcatmaintainer zhangchen 61037@qq.com COPY jpress.war /usr/local/tomcat/webapps
sql

        • 直接構建
          docker build .​docker images(發現一個none,代表構建成功了.)​​
        • 構建並命名
          docker build -t jpress:latest .

4.拉取mysql鏡像,建立jpress數據庫
docker pull hub.c.163.com/library/mysql:latest​docker run -d -p 3306:3306 -e MYSQL_ROOT_PASSWORD=123456 -e MYSQL_DATABASE=jpress hub.c.163.com/library/mysql​(帳號root 密碼123456)
數據庫

5.運行鏡像
docker run -d -p 8080:8080 jpress
vim

7.重啓jress容器,從新進入網站
docker restart [containerId]

        • 進入網站
相關文章
相關標籤/搜索